Output 3bfeb5c3d7d4e62bf3af16b994e71177e2820cdbbf294cd4cb620df09afa4766:23

value
518782
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b242a53a199c95801504206b6898f607b9425c19 OP_EQUALVERIFY OP_CHECKSIG
address
1HFZ7kY6SuHvNDhiFkvvqdoZ4UvnWTSPRL
transaction
3bfeb5c3d7d4e62bf3af16b994e71177e2820cdbbf294cd4cb620df09afa4766
spent
true